From 02007b1fe9110b6dfdedf765b96da0968a545423 Mon Sep 17 00:00:00 2001 From: Olojakpoke Daniel Date: Mon, 18 Apr 2022 21:25:37 +0100 Subject: [PATCH] fix: modify update stakeholder schema --- server/handlers/stakeholderHandler.js |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/server/handlers/stakeholderHandler.js b/server/handlers/stakeholderHandler.js index d0b9dff..d4c076d 100644 --- a/server/handlers/stakeholderHandler.js +++ b/server/handlers/stakeholderHandler.js @@ -32,9 +32,14 @@ const stakeholderDeleteSchema = Joi.object({ const updateStakeholderSchema = Joi.object({ id: Joi.string().uuid().required(), - type: Joi.string(), - email: Joi.string(), + email: Joi.string().email(), + first_name: Joi.string(), + last_name: Joi.string(), + logo_url: Joi.string(), + map: Joi.string(), + org_name: Joi.string(), phone: Joi.string(), + website: Joi.string().uri(), }).unknown(false); const stakeholderGetAll = async (req, res) => {